South Fork posts 26% meeting the standard and 8.3% exceeding it, against 43% and 21.6% statewide. The gaps and the bright spots below are the real read.
South Fork Elementary scores 32 of 100 on SchoolScope's Scope Score — the 29th percentile of 5,230 California elementary schools (CDE CAASPP 2025).
Measures test performance, attendance, and climate — not arts, community, or your kid. How we score →
Most rating sites would stop at “26% proficient” and call it done. South Fork deserves a closer read. The school sits in Weldon, where three in four students qualify for free or reduced lunch — and reading the numbers without that context misreads the school.

ELA · CAASPP 2024–25Different students, same year — each bar is one grade's proficiency mix.
The honest read: the share exceeding rises 15.2pp across grades; the floor rises 16.5pp. The state average rises 4.5pp over the same span. Kids here gain ground the longer they stay — the pattern you want to see. A school visit and conversation with teachers will tell you more than this number.
